y = 4(x - 2)² - 1 y = 4(x² - 4x + 4) - 1 y = 4x² - 16x + 16 - 1 y = 4x² - 16x + 15

Ok so your original equation was y=4(x-2)²-1 Therefore we need to expand the bracket to find the original equation. To do this we need to find (x-2)²=x²-4x+4 Now we multiply this by 4 and subtract 1 4x²-16x+15 Therefore B is the answer
The standard form of the given parabola y = 4 ( x − 2 ) 2 − 1 is y = 4 x 2 − 16 x + 15 . The answer is option B. This was found by expanding the vertex form and simplifying the expression.
